Who Are These People Buying Homes for Cash—and Why So Fast?

In today’s fast-moving real estate market, more homeowners are encountering buyers who offer to purchase homes for cash—and close in days, not weeks. But who exactly are these people? Why are they so eager, and is this option safe or smart for sellers?

Let’s break down what’s behind the cash home buying trend and how you can navigate it with confidence.

What Does It Mean to Sell a House for Cash?

When someone offers to buy your home “for cash,” it doesn’t mean they’re showing up with a briefcase of bills. It means they have liquid funds available—often in a bank account or through an investment fund—and can purchase the home without using a mortgage.

A cash sale usually means:

  • No lender involvement
  • Fewer contingencies
  • Faster closings—sometimes in under a week
  • Potentially lower offers, since cash buyers often seek deals

Cash sales are attractive to homeowners looking for speed, convenience, or to avoid costly repairs and delays.

Who Typically Buys Homes for Cash?

Real Estate Investors

Investors buy homes for cash as part of their business strategy. Their goal is usually to buy low, improve the property (or hold onto it), and eventually sell or rent it for profit. Investors are savvy and fast—they know what they want and how to close quickly.

House Flippers

These are short-term investors who specialize in buying distressed or outdated properties, renovating them, and reselling at a higher price. Flippers love cash deals because they’re quick and let them move on to the next project without delay.

Buy-and-Hold Landlords

Some cash buyers are landlords looking for rental properties. They prefer cash deals to avoid long approval processes and competition. Their goal is long-term income, not quick resale, so they often buy in areas with stable rental demand.

iBuyers and Cash Buying Companies

Companies like Opendoor, Offerpad, and smaller local firms are known as iBuyers. They use data and algorithms to quickly assess home values and make cash offers—often online. These companies promise convenience, but usually buy slightly below market value to make a profit on resale.

Why Do Cash Buyers Move So Quickly?

Access to Immediate Funds

Cash buyers already have the money ready—whether from savings, investments, or credit lines. This eliminates the long loan approval process that slows down traditional sales.

Motivated by Investment Opportunities

Many cash buyers operate in competitive markets. When they spot a good deal, they need to act fast before someone else does. Their speed helps them secure more deals and build their portfolios.

Skipping Mortgage Delays

Traditional sales can fall apart if a buyer’s mortgage is denied last-minute. Cash buyers avoid this entirely, giving sellers more certainty and peace of mind.

Pros and Cons of Selling to a Cash Buyer

Pros:

  • Fast closings (as little as 7 days)
  • No need for repairs or staging
  • Fewer fees and no appraisals
  • Less chance of the deal falling through

Cons:

  • Offers are usually below market value
  • Some buyers may pressure you to accept quickly
  • Scams do exist—due diligence is key

Is Selling for Cash the Right Move for You?

Selling for cash can be a great solution if you:

  • Need to move quickly
  • Are facing foreclosure or financial stress
  • Own a distressed property
  • Inherited a home you don’t want to maintain

However, if you have time and your home is in good shape, you may get more money selling traditionally.

Questions to Ask Before Signing

Before accepting a cash offer, ask the buyer:

  • Are there any fees I’ll need to pay?
  • Will you inspect the home before closing?
  • What is your expected timeline?
  • Are you assigning the contract or buying it directly?
